Host Sandra Levine interviews experts on caregiving, trauma, grief, and other intense challenges to provide a road map for survival. Heroes and healers, adventurers and innovators encourage you to pursue more self-care, reflection, connection, and fun—and your own unique and joyful purpose.
Sandra is a television producer, filmmaker, and speaker who spent 20 years as a caregiver, first for her husband Michael, who had a brain injury, and then for her mother Dorothy, who had Alzheimer's Disease. She created this show to share lessons learned from those experiences to help you get through difficult times, too.

Remembering Rare Neurological Illness (ADEM) Sparks Painful Memories & Gratitude 26 Years Later
On Halloween,1999, Sandra Levine's husband, Michael, was rushed by helicopter to the Hospital of the University of Pennsylvania due to Acute Disseminated Encephalomyelitis, or ADEM. Michael nearly died -- twice. His recovery was long and very difficult, lasting many years.
And while Michael eventually made a remarkable recovery, even after 26 years, challenges remain. Both Sandra and Michael say while some of the memories are painful, looking back on how far they've come, sparks deep feelings of gratitude.
